Joint meeting of Moldovan, Romanian governments likely to be held in September

13:11 | 11.08.2021 Category: Official

Chisinau, 11 August /MOLDPRES/- Yesterday, Prime Minister Natalia Gavrilița had a meeting with Romanian Ambassador Daniel Ioniță, the government's communication and protocol department has reported.

In the context of the discussion with Prime Minister of Romania Florin Cîțu, the two officials planned the preparation of a joint meeting of the Governments of Romania and the Republic of Moldova, due in September.

Stages of preparing for the resumption and extension of the intergovernmental agreement for non-reimbursable technical assistance were established. Romania is an active supporter of the modernization of our country and the relationship has an enormous development potential, from which all citizens will benefit.
